We are seeking an experienced Agile Release Train (ART) Program Manager to lead the cost and schedule performance of our ART teams. The successful candidate will be responsible for resolving roadblocks, ensuring team staffing and capacity, reviewing and approving variances, and prioritizing and resolving impediments. This role requires strong communication and coordination skills, as well as the ability to drive cost performance, manage risks, and develop decision-making metrics. A key aspect of this position will be transforming the culture of the program to embrace agile and iterative development concepts.
Key Responsibilities:
  • Lead the cost and schedule performance of the ART, ensuring timely and within-budget delivery of program objectives
  • Coordinate with OBS managers and RTE to resolve roadblocks and impediments
  • Collaborate with OBS leads to ensure team staffing and capacity align with schedule requirements
  • Review and approve variances, and provide approval for PI planning outbriefs
  • Prioritize and resolve impediments in conjunction with the RTE
  • Provide direction to the ART and its teams to meet cost and schedule objectives
  • Maintain awareness of TPCL and help define and shape future capabilities
  • Guide design concepts and criteria, and integrate new capabilities through PI planning
  • Communicate program scope, deliverables, and priorities to the ART team
  • Foster bi-directional and transparent communication with the
ART, TED
PM, and executive leadership
  • Coordinate with cross-disciplinary teams, including ARTs and OBS functions
  • Manage ART risks, determine which risks to elevate to the Program ROMB, and develop mitigation strategies
  • Develop and present program metrics, including IBR content, at PDPWG and STAR meetings
  • Provide input into CPAR comment responses and coordinate with customers on product status, performance, and challenges/risks Desired skills
